CVS Specialty Pharmacy Salary

How much does the CVS Specialty Pharmacy Pay for employees?

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at CVS Specialty Pharmacy in the United States is $89,785.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$43. Salaries at CVS Specialty Pharmacy typically range from $78,944 to $101,575 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. CVS Specialty Pharmacy’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Lenexa?

Understanding the cost of living near Lenexa is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at CVS Specialty Pharmacy.
Lenexa's Cost of Living Index is approximately 105.8 (5.8% more expensive than US average; 17.9% more than KS average). Kansas City suburb (Johnson Co.), desirable, housing costs above US avg.
